Norway’s Royal House cancels parliament dinner

What should have been the 103rd parliament dinner at the castle of the Norwegian royal family has been canceled as a result of the coronavirus situation, according to the Royal House.

The dinner for Norwegian parliament (Storting) representatives, the government, and other officials in Norway was scheduled to take place on October 22.

The dinner has been held regularly ever since King Haakon invited the parliamentary representatives to dinner at the castle in 1906.

It has been skipped only a few times in the past.

On Friday morning, King Harald was admitted to the Rikshospitalet.
